Session windows and weekly limits
Claude subscriptions use five-hour session windows, with additional weekly limits on paid plans. A session refresh does not necessarily clear another limit. Check Settings → Usage for your account.

| Plan | Published allowance | Where to check |
|---|---|---|
| Free | Base allowance | Settings → Usage |
| Pro | More than Free | Settings → Usage |
| Max 5x | 5× Pro per session | Settings → Usage |
| Max 20x | 20× Pro per session | Settings → Usage |

Why is there no fixed weekly message count?
Conversation size, task complexity, model and features affect consumption. Subscription usage across Claude web, desktop and Claude Code shares an allowance, so changing clients does not create a fresh quota.

What can you do after reaching a limit?
Check the reset time in your usage display. Eligible paid accounts can enable usage credits to continue, subject to credit balance and spending controls. This adds charges; it is not a free manual reset.

Frequently asked questions
Does Claude reset at midnight?
Do not rely on a universal midnight countdown. Check the session and other reset windows shown in your account’s usage page.
Why am I still limited after a session refresh?
Another limit may still apply. Check weekly usage, your account and product; consult the official status page if the service appears unavailable.
Does an API 429 mean my subscription ran out?
Not necessarily. API billing and rate limits are separate. Diagnose API errors in its console rather than applying the subscription’s five-hour window.
